Bug 230296

Summary: Plasma Workspace Crash Probably Stemming from Quicklaunch Widget, Perhaps in Conjunction with the Dashboard
Product: [Unmaintained] plasma4 Reporter: Eccentric Concentric <concentric.eccentric>
Component: generalAssignee: Plasma Bugs List <plasma-bugs>
Status: RESOLVED FIXED    
Severity: crash CC: aseigo
Priority: NOR    
Version: unspecified   
Target Milestone: ---   
Platform: Compiled Sources   
OS: Linux   
Latest Commit: Version Fixed In:
Sentry Crash Report:

Description Eccentric Concentric 2010-03-11 05:05:09 UTC
Application: plasma-desktop (0.3)
KDE Platform Version: 4.4.00 (KDE 4.4.0) (Compiled from sources)
Qt Version: 4.6.2
Operating System: Linux 2.6.31.12-174.2.22.fc12.x86_64 x86_64
Distribution (Platform): Fedora RPMs

-- Information about the crash:
I was on the widget dashboard, and attempting to click an icon on the Quicklaunch widget (where I probably accidentally dragged) when it crashed.

 -- Backtrace:
Application: Plasma Workspace (plasma-desktop), signal: Segmentation fault
82	T_PSEUDO (SYSCALL_SYMBOL, SYSCALL_NAME, SYSCALL_NARGS)
[KCrash Handler]
#5  QGraphicsWidget::resize (this=0x70006f0074006b, size=...) at graphicsview/qgraphicswidget.cpp:309
#6  0x00007ff0f497f0ab in QuicklaunchApplet::performUiRefactor (this=0x2035980) at /usr/src/debug/kdebase-workspace-4.4.0/plasma/generic/applets/quicklaunch/quicklaunchApplet.cpp:239
#7  0x00007ff0f49811a6 in QuicklaunchApplet::dropApp (this=0x2035980, event=0x7fff99dab060, droppedOnDialog=<value optimized out>)
    at /usr/src/debug/kdebase-workspace-4.4.0/plasma/generic/applets/quicklaunch/quicklaunchApplet.cpp:557
#8  0x00007ff0f498142c in QuicklaunchApplet::eventFilter (this=0x2035980, object=0x2a1a8a0, event=0x7fff99dab060)
    at /usr/src/debug/kdebase-workspace-4.4.0/plasma/generic/applets/quicklaunch/quicklaunchApplet.cpp:603
#9  0x0000003002956b67 in QCoreApplicationPrivate::sendThroughObjectEventFilters (this=<value optimized out>, receiver=0x2a1a8a0, event=0x7fff99dab060) at kernel/qcoreapplication.cpp:819
#10 0x000000300a9aa9ac in QApplicationPrivate::notify_helper (this=0x1762700, receiver=0x2a1a8a0, e=0x7fff99dab060) at kernel/qapplication.cpp:4296
#11 0x000000300a9b0aab in QApplication::notify (this=<value optimized out>, receiver=0x2a1a8a0, e=0x7fff99dab060) at kernel/qapplication.cpp:4183
#12 0x0000003005e067a6 in KApplication::notify (this=0x174b810, receiver=0x2a1a8a0, event=0x7fff99dab060) at /usr/src/debug/kdelibs-4.4.0/kdeui/kernel/kapplication.cpp:302
#13 0x000000300295774c in QCoreApplication::notifyInternal (this=0x174b810, receiver=0x2a1a8a0, event=0x7fff99dab060) at kernel/qcoreapplication.cpp:704
#14 0x000000300af589b1 in sendEvent (this=<value optimized out>, item=0x2a1a8b0, event=0x7fff99dab060) at ../../src/corelib/kernel/qcoreapplication.h:215
#15 QGraphicsScenePrivate::sendEvent (this=<value optimized out>, item=0x2a1a8b0, event=0x7fff99dab060) at graphicsview/qgraphicsscene.cpp:1177
#16 0x000000300af58ddc in QGraphicsScenePrivate::sendDragDropEvent (this=0x186dd80, item=0x2a1a8b0, dragDropEvent=0x7fff99dab060) at graphicsview/qgraphicsscene.cpp:1210
#17 0x000000300af58e1c in QGraphicsScene::dropEvent (this=<value optimized out>, event=<value optimized out>) at graphicsview/qgraphicsscene.cpp:3691
#18 0x000000300af7002f in QGraphicsScene::event (this=0x187ce10, event=0x7fff99dab060) at graphicsview/qgraphicsscene.cpp:3349
#19 0x000000300a9aa9dc in QApplicationPrivate::notify_helper (this=0x1762700, receiver=0x187ce10, e=0x7fff99dab060) at kernel/qapplication.cpp:4300
#20 0x000000300a9b0aab in QApplication::notify (this=<value optimized out>, receiver=0x187ce10, e=0x7fff99dab060) at kernel/qapplication.cpp:4183
#21 0x0000003005e067a6 in KApplication::notify (this=0x174b810, receiver=0x187ce10, event=0x7fff99dab060) at /usr/src/debug/kdelibs-4.4.0/kdeui/kernel/kapplication.cpp:302
#22 0x000000300295774c in QCoreApplication::notifyInternal (this=0x174b810, receiver=0x187ce10, event=0x7fff99dab060) at kernel/qcoreapplication.cpp:704
#23 0x000000300af86f8a in sendEvent (this=<value optimized out>, event=0x7fff99dab8f0) at ../../src/corelib/kernel/qcoreapplication.h:215
#24 QGraphicsView::dropEvent (this=<value optimized out>, event=0x7fff99dab8f0) at graphicsview/qgraphicsview.cpp:2833
#25 0x000000300a9f5b08 in QWidget::event (this=0x2aa5af0, event=0x7fff99dab8f0) at kernel/qwidget.cpp:8188
#26 0x000000300ad70646 in QFrame::event (this=0x2aa5af0, e=0x7fff99dab8f0) at widgets/qframe.cpp:557
#27 0x000000300af85ecb in QGraphicsView::viewportEvent (this=0x2aa5af0, event=0x7fff99dab8f0) at graphicsview/qgraphicsview.cpp:2787
#28 0x0000003002956b67 in QCoreApplicationPrivate::sendThroughObjectEventFilters (this=<value optimized out>, receiver=0x2abbb40, event=0x7fff99dab8f0) at kernel/qcoreapplication.cpp:819
#29 0x000000300a9aa9ac in QApplicationPrivate::notify_helper (this=0x1762700, receiver=0x2abbb40, e=0x7fff99dab8f0) at kernel/qapplication.cpp:4296
#30 0x000000300a9b0d18 in QApplication::notify (this=<value optimized out>, receiver=<value optimized out>, e=0x7fff99dab8f0) at kernel/qapplication.cpp:4108
#31 0x0000003005e067a6 in KApplication::notify (this=0x174b810, receiver=0x2abbb40, event=0x7fff99dab8f0) at /usr/src/debug/kdelibs-4.4.0/kdeui/kernel/kapplication.cpp:302
#32 0x000000300295774c in QCoreApplication::notifyInternal (this=0x174b810, receiver=0x2abbb40, event=0x7fff99dab8f0) at kernel/qcoreapplication.cpp:704
#33 0x000000300aa2eb8a in sendEvent (this=<value optimized out>, xe=<value optimized out>, passive=<value optimized out>) at ../../src/corelib/kernel/qcoreapplication.h:215
#34 QX11Data::xdndHandleDrop (this=<value optimized out>, xe=<value optimized out>, passive=<value optimized out>) at kernel/qdnd_x11.cpp:1164
#35 0x000000300aa2eec0 in QDragManager::drop (this=0x2bc6d60) at kernel/qdnd_x11.cpp:1700
#36 0x000000300aa30f70 in QDragManager::eventFilter (this=0x2bc6d60, o=<value optimized out>, e=<value optimized out>) at kernel/qdnd_x11.cpp:1293
#37 0x0000003002956c2b in QCoreApplicationPrivate::sendThroughApplicationEventFilters (this=0x1762700, receiver=0x179c040, event=0x7fff99dac1b0) at kernel/qcoreapplication.cpp:800
#38 0x000000300a9aa956 in QApplicationPrivate::notify_helper (this=0x1762700, receiver=0x179c040, e=0x7fff99dac1b0) at kernel/qapplication.cpp:4275
#39 0x000000300a9b127d in QApplication::notify (this=<value optimized out>, receiver=0x179c040, e=0x7fff99dac1b0) at kernel/qapplication.cpp:3865
#40 0x0000003005e067a6 in KApplication::notify (this=0x174b810, receiver=0x179c040, event=0x7fff99dac1b0) at /usr/src/debug/kdelibs-4.4.0/kdeui/kernel/kapplication.cpp:302
#41 0x000000300295774c in QCoreApplication::notifyInternal (this=0x174b810, receiver=0x179c040, event=0x7fff99dac1b0) at kernel/qcoreapplication.cpp:704
#42 0x000000300a9b046e in sendEvent (receiver=0x179c040, event=0x7fff99dac1b0, alienWidget=0x0, nativeWidget=0x179c040, buttonDown=<value optimized out>, lastMouseReceiver=<value optimized out>, 
    spontaneous=true) at ../../src/corelib/kernel/qcoreapplication.h:215
#43 QApplicationPrivate::sendMouseEvent (receiver=0x179c040, event=0x7fff99dac1b0, alienWidget=0x0, nativeWidget=0x179c040, buttonDown=<value optimized out>, lastMouseReceiver=<value optimized out>, 
    spontaneous=true) at kernel/qapplication.cpp:2965
#44 0x000000300aa22405 in QETWidget::translateMouseEvent (this=0x179c040, event=<value optimized out>) at kernel/qapplication_x11.cpp:4368
#45 0x000000300aa21128 in QApplication::x11ProcessEvent (this=<value optimized out>, event=0x7fff99dacad0) at kernel/qapplication_x11.cpp:3501
#46 0x000000300aa49d52 in x11EventSourceDispatch (s=0x1765dd0, callback=<value optimized out>, user_data=<value optimized out>) at kernel/qguieventdispatcher_glib.cpp:146
#47 0x00000035f163920e in g_main_dispatch (context=0x1764d20) at gmain.c:1960
#48 IA__g_main_context_dispatch (context=0x1764d20) at gmain.c:2513
#49 0x00000035f163cbf8 in g_main_context_iterate (context=0x1764d20, block=<value optimized out>, dispatch=<value optimized out>, self=<value optimized out>) at gmain.c:2591
#50 0x00000035f163cd1a in IA__g_main_context_iteration (context=0x1764d20, may_block=1) at gmain.c:2654
#51 0x000000300297d063 in QEventDispatcherGlib::processEvents (this=0x1733510, flags=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:412
#52 0x000000300aa49a1e in QGuiEventDispatcherGlib::processEvents (this=<value optimized out>, flags=<value optimized out>) at kernel/qguieventdispatcher_glib.cpp:204
#53 0x0000003002956192 in QEventLoop::processEvents (this=<value optimized out>, flags=...) at kernel/qeventloop.cpp:149
#54 0x000000300295645c in QEventLoop::exec (this=0x36610d0, flags=...) at kernel/qeventloop.cpp:201
#55 0x000000300aa33aec in QDragManager::drag (this=0x2bc6d60, o=<value optimized out>) at kernel/qdnd_x11.cpp:1960
#56 0x000000300a9bdec8 in QDrag::exec (this=0x1c132d0, supportedActions=..., defaultDropAction=IgnoreAction) at kernel/qdrag.cpp:282
#57 0x000000300a9bdf83 in QDrag::exec (this=<value optimized out>, supportedActions=<value optimized out>) at kernel/qdrag.cpp:239
#58 0x00007ff0f49816fe in QuicklaunchApplet::eventFilter (this=0x2035980, object=0x2a1a8a0, event=0x7fff99dade60)
    at /usr/src/debug/kdebase-workspace-4.4.0/plasma/generic/applets/quicklaunch/quicklaunchApplet.cpp:582
#59 0x0000003002956b67 in QCoreApplicationPrivate::sendThroughObjectEventFilters (this=<value optimized out>, receiver=0x2a1a8a0, event=0x7fff99dade60) at kernel/qcoreapplication.cpp:819
#60 0x000000300a9aa9ac in QApplicationPrivate::notify_helper (this=0x1762700, receiver=0x2a1a8a0, e=0x7fff99dade60) at kernel/qapplication.cpp:4296
#61 0x000000300a9b0aab in QApplication::notify (this=<value optimized out>, receiver=0x2a1a8a0, e=0x7fff99dade60) at kernel/qapplication.cpp:4183
#62 0x0000003005e067a6 in KApplication::notify (this=0x174b810, receiver=0x2a1a8a0, event=0x7fff99dade60) at /usr/src/debug/kdelibs-4.4.0/kdeui/kernel/kapplication.cpp:302
#63 0x000000300295774c in QCoreApplication::notifyInternal (this=0x174b810, receiver=0x2a1a8a0, event=0x7fff99dade60) at kernel/qcoreapplication.cpp:704
#64 0x000000300af58a0b in QGraphicsScenePrivate::sendEvent (this=<value optimized out>, item=0x2a1a8b0, event=0x7fff99dade60) at graphicsview/qgraphicsscene.cpp:1177
#65 0x000000300af59fa8 in QGraphicsScenePrivate::sendMouseEvent (this=0x186dd80, mouseEvent=0x7fff99dade60) at graphicsview/qgraphicsscene.cpp:1255
#66 0x000000300af5e011 in QGraphicsScene::mouseMoveEvent (this=<value optimized out>, mouseEvent=0x7fff99dade60) at graphicsview/qgraphicsscene.cpp:4031
#67 0x000000300af7019b in QGraphicsScene::event (this=0x187ce10, event=0x7fff99dade60) at graphicsview/qgraphicsscene.cpp:3391
#68 0x000000300a9aa9dc in QApplicationPrivate::notify_helper (this=0x1762700, receiver=0x187ce10, e=0x7fff99dade60) at kernel/qapplication.cpp:4300
#69 0x000000300a9b0aab in QApplication::notify (this=<value optimized out>, receiver=0x187ce10, e=0x7fff99dade60) at kernel/qapplication.cpp:4183
#70 0x0000003005e067a6 in KApplication::notify (this=0x174b810, receiver=0x187ce10, event=0x7fff99dade60) at /usr/src/debug/kdelibs-4.4.0/kdeui/kernel/kapplication.cpp:302
#71 0x000000300295774c in QCoreApplication::notifyInternal (this=0x174b810, receiver=0x187ce10, event=0x7fff99dade60) at kernel/qcoreapplication.cpp:704
#72 0x000000300af89a27 in QGraphicsViewPrivate::mouseMoveEventHandler (this=0x2aa52b0, event=0x7fff99dae9c0) at graphicsview/qgraphicsview.cpp:645
#73 0x000000300af89c1e in QGraphicsView::mouseMoveEvent (this=0x2aa5af0, event=0x7fff99dae9c0) at graphicsview/qgraphicsview.cpp:3197
#74 0x000000300a9f5797 in QWidget::event (this=0x2aa5af0, event=0x7fff99dae9c0) at kernel/qwidget.cpp:7983
#75 0x000000300ad70646 in QFrame::event (this=0x2aa5af0, e=0x7fff99dae9c0) at widgets/qframe.cpp:557
#76 0x000000300af85ecb in QGraphicsView::viewportEvent (this=0x2aa5af0, event=0x7fff99dae9c0) at graphicsview/qgraphicsview.cpp:2787
#77 0x0000003002956b67 in QCoreApplicationPrivate::sendThroughObjectEventFilters (this=<value optimized out>, receiver=0x2abbb40, event=0x7fff99dae9c0) at kernel/qcoreapplication.cpp:819
#78 0x000000300a9aa9ac in QApplicationPrivate::notify_helper (this=0x1762700, receiver=0x2abbb40, e=0x7fff99dae9c0) at kernel/qapplication.cpp:4296
#79 0x000000300a9b127d in QApplication::notify (this=<value optimized out>, receiver=0x2abbb40, e=0x7fff99dae9c0) at kernel/qapplication.cpp:3865
#80 0x0000003005e067a6 in KApplication::notify (this=0x174b810, receiver=0x2abbb40, event=0x7fff99dae9c0) at /usr/src/debug/kdelibs-4.4.0/kdeui/kernel/kapplication.cpp:302
#81 0x000000300295774c in QCoreApplication::notifyInternal (this=0x174b810, receiver=0x2abbb40, event=0x7fff99dae9c0) at kernel/qcoreapplication.cpp:704
#82 0x000000300a9b046e in sendEvent (receiver=0x2abbb40, event=0x7fff99dae9c0, alienWidget=0x2abbb40, nativeWidget=0x2aa5af0, buttonDown=<value optimized out>, 
    lastMouseReceiver=<value optimized out>, spontaneous=true) at ../../src/corelib/kernel/qcoreapplication.h:215
#83 QApplicationPrivate::sendMouseEvent (receiver=0x2abbb40, event=0x7fff99dae9c0, alienWidget=0x2abbb40, nativeWidget=0x2aa5af0, buttonDown=<value optimized out>, 
    lastMouseReceiver=<value optimized out>, spontaneous=true) at kernel/qapplication.cpp:2965
#84 0x000000300aa22405 in QETWidget::translateMouseEvent (this=0x2aa5af0, event=<value optimized out>) at kernel/qapplication_x11.cpp:4368
#85 0x000000300aa21128 in QApplication::x11ProcessEvent (this=<value optimized out>, event=0x7fff99daf2e0) at kernel/qapplication_x11.cpp:3501
#86 0x000000300aa49d52 in x11EventSourceDispatch (s=0x1765dd0, callback=<value optimized out>, user_data=<value optimized out>) at kernel/qguieventdispatcher_glib.cpp:146
#87 0x00000035f163920e in g_main_dispatch (context=0x1764d20) at gmain.c:1960
#88 IA__g_main_context_dispatch (context=0x1764d20) at gmain.c:2513
#89 0x00000035f163cbf8 in g_main_context_iterate (context=0x1764d20, block=<value optimized out>, dispatch=<value optimized out>, self=<value optimized out>) at gmain.c:2591
#90 0x00000035f163cd1a in IA__g_main_context_iteration (context=0x1764d20, may_block=1) at gmain.c:2654
#91 0x000000300297d063 in QEventDispatcherGlib::processEvents (this=0x1733510, flags=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:412
#92 0x000000300aa49a1e in QGuiEventDispatcherGlib::processEvents (this=<value optimized out>, flags=<value optimized out>) at kernel/qguieventdispatcher_glib.cpp:204
#93 0x0000003002956192 in QEventLoop::processEvents (this=<value optimized out>, flags=...) at kernel/qeventloop.cpp:149
#94 0x000000300295645c in QEventLoop::exec (this=0x7fff99daf610, flags=...) at kernel/qeventloop.cpp:201
#95 0x0000003002958749 in QCoreApplication::exec () at kernel/qcoreapplication.cpp:981
#96 0x0000003009c37e52 in kdemain (argc=<value optimized out>, argv=<value optimized out>) at /usr/src/debug/kdebase-workspace-4.4.0/plasma/desktop/shell/main.cpp:112
#97 0x000000378b01eb1d in __libc_start_main (main=<value optimized out>, argc=<value optimized out>, ubp_av=<value optimized out>, init=<value optimized out>, fini=<value optimized out>, 
    rtld_fini=<value optimized out>, stack_end=<value optimized out>) at libc-start.c:226
#98 0x00000000004007c9 in _start ()

This bug may be a duplicate of or related to bug 225011.

Possible duplicates by query: bug 228102, bug 225011.

Reported using DrKonqi
Comment 1 Aaron J. Seigo 2010-03-11 06:26:48 UTC
recently fixed in svn.